Wind slab avalanches have continued to be reactive throughout this storm cycle with additional human triggered wind slab avalanches reported yesterday. Strong to gale force SW/W winds yesterday and overnight built out additional dense wind slabs. As the winds shift to the NW today and then to the N tonight, new wind slab development will be possible on any aspect in near and above treeline areas.
Look for recent wind slab avalanches, blowing snow, new cornice formation, and dense wind pillows as clues to where wind slabs may exist. Make a travel plan to avoid these leeward slopes near ridges and open areas exposed to blowing snow. Cornices have become built out and large and will remain fragile again today.
